Ethereum Core developers announced on Tuesday that they would postpone their much-awaited Constantinople hard fork. The team, which has previously settled January 16 as the official date for the Ethereum blockchain upgrade, decided to delay it after ChainSecurity found potential vulnerabilities in the code.
